So, I'm happily on my way to the final bunker in Forsaken Airfield. I saw the note on the wiki that it only pickups up the signal near the entrance to the region, so I trekked back to the Far Range, and camped out for a few days then re-entered the region during an aurora. Right at the entrance I picked up the signal for the final bunker. But after a short time walking farther into the region, the signal vanished again, although the aurora was still strong (and the radio was still lit up).

Is this still part of the glitch, or does the signal disappear if you're too far from the target location? I hadn't even made it to the first car along the road from the entrance.

I know the general area that the bunker will be in. Do I need to go all the way along the round, around the bottom mountain range, then back into the lower elevation part of the region to then pick up the signal again? Or, should the radio pick up a signal no matter where I am in the region and point me in the correct direction?

(I had luck with the other regions and was never more than half a map away from them when first pulling out the radio, so never had a radio fail to give a direction.)

TL;DR - does the final bunker only ping the radio if you are close enough to it, once you've picked up the signal at least once? Ie does walking too far "left/west" on the online maps make you loose the signal?

The signal will come back once you get closer (again... since I think the road leads you farther away, after being "closer", if that makes any sense).
